A NEED TO BE HUMBLE

Lord, you gave me this trial,
to open my eyes wide.
Because I needed to be humbled,
to lessen my pride.

The ways of the world,
were once again affecting me.
I needed this lesson Lord,
for my soul to remain free.

I did not mean to be sinful,
to fall away from your grace.
This trial has helped me Lord,
to again know my true place.

Now I will try once again,
to do as I have been told.
To follow your example Lord,
not to live my life so bold.

My Lord of mercy, compassion,
and unlimited love.
Thank you for looking after me,
from Heaven far above.


By Gerry Eggleston 7/00
